Comparative evaluation of efficacy of three port and four port technique of Laparoscopic Cholecystectomy
Arshad Jamal

Background: It was in the year 1987 that the first laparoscopic cholecystectomy (LC) was performed. Since then, there have been many changes and improvements in the technique. Hence; under the light of above mentioned data, the present study was planned to compare the efficacy of three port and four port technique of LC. Materials & methods: A total of 80 patient scheduled to undergo LC were included in the present study and were broadly divided into two study groups with 40 patients in each group; Group A included patients undergoing three port LC; and Group B included patients undergoing four port LC.  A self-framed questionnaire was made collecting all the pre-operative details the subjects enrolled in the study. Blood samples were taken preoperatively from all the patients and complete hematological and biochemical profile was assessed. All the patients underwent LC according their respective groups. All the postoperative parameters were recorded on follow-up for comparing the efficacy of the two techniques. Results: Non-significant results were obtained while comparing the intraoperative findings among subjects of group A and group B. Mean operative time among subjects of group A was 49.25 minutes and was significantly lesser than that of subjects of group B (65.22 minutes). Mean patient satisfaction score of subjects of group A was 7.5 and mean patient satisfaction score of subjects of group B was 7. Conclusion: The three port and four port technique of LC can be used with equal efficacy in gallstone patients.
